Output ed80ee8cac312a15a1051cca49356ad94e790cc166cd77e2c55be213c4dde9ff:1

value
8689632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f102429ac160639e348e67673a4ffca9dce54f24 OP_EQUAL
address
3PfMUpCJ8FEP66MxjzazNZkNMUMmdwqQd5
transaction
ed80ee8cac312a15a1051cca49356ad94e790cc166cd77e2c55be213c4dde9ff
confirmations
321813
spent
true